Dildos

A dildo is one of the most popular sex toys for women due to its versatility. It is a non-vibrating toy used for penetration and internal massage, and can have an anatomical design to resemble an actual penis, or be non-anatomical with no penis resemblance whatsoever.

Dildos come in various shapes and sizes. You can choose from big dildos, mini dildos, metal or glass dildos, textured dildos, or even curved dildos to directly target the G-spot. While vaginal penetration and G-spot stimulation are common uses of dildos, they can also be used for anal penetration to stimulate the nerve endings in that area.

Vibrators

You may have heard that no bedroom is complete without a vibrator of some sort. Vibrators are specifically designed to help achieve orgasm no matter which part of the body they are used on. They vibrate to stimulate erogenous zones and come in a variety of types.

Choosing the best vibrator depends on your preference for stimulation. External styles are designed to stimulate the clitoris, while internal styles massage the vagina and G-spot. The rabbit vibrator provides both internal and external stimulation simultaneously, with a vibrating vaginal shaft and external ears that vibrate against the clitoris.

Clitoral Massager

A clitoral massager is one of the top female sex toys for helping women achieve orgasm. In fact, 75% of women need clitoral stimulation to reach orgasm and these clit stimulation toys are designed to do just that. The range of clitoral vibes available is vast, from large and powerful wand vibrators to smaller bullet vibes. Bullet vibes can be used alone or with a partner during sex as they are small enough to not get in the way.

Moreover, there has been a rise in toys that simulate oral sex using suction and pulsing waves around the clitoris, rather than vibration alone, to bring the user to orgasm. There are a lot of clitoral toys to choose from, and the best clitoral vibrator depends on your preferences and how you want to use the toy.

Butt Plug

Female sex toys are not only targeted at the vulva and the vagina, though. Butt plugs have seen a significant increase in popularity over the past few years, as sex toys have become more mainstream. Butt plugs come in varying shapes and sizes and are designed to create a full feeling in the anus. You can wear a butt plug during masturbation or during partnered play to give your body even more sensation as your sphincter muscles tighten around the plug.

In fact, many people use butt plugs to prepare their body for anal sex. They are used to relax and stretch the muscles, making the entry of a penis or a larger toy easier and more comfortable. You may also want to consider a vibrating butt plug for even more stimulation or even a tail butt plug for animal roleplay or for a cute and playful look.

Anal Beads

If you want to explore anal play but find a butt plug a little intimidating, another option is to start off with a set of anal beads. Anal beads are a chain of connected spheres starting small and gradually increasing in size. They are great for beginners because the beads only need to be inserted as far as you feel comfortable with, and you will still get all the amazing benefits.

This is because anal beads stimulate the nerve endings at the opening of the anus, an area that has thousands of nerve endings, much more than the internal canal. The entry and removal of the beads offer the most pleasure. Anal beads can be used alone or with a partner during any kind of play. Try slowly removing the beads during or before orgasm, as it can make your orgasm feel a whole lot more intense.

Nipple Clamps

The nipple is often an overlooked erogenous zone of the body when it comes to sex toys. This is because nipple clamps are commonly associated with pain rather than pleasure. However, the type of clamp you use is what determines the experience. Nipple clamps work by pinching the nipples and restricting blood flow to the area, which can cause some pain if tugged on while being worn. But their main purpose is actually the effect when the clamps are removed.

Once removed from the body, the blood rushes back to the nipple, creating a surge of sensation and endorphins. The nipple becomes more sensitive and responsive to touching, licking or pinching. If you are new to nipple clamps, look for an adjustable style so you can find the level of pressure you like, such as tweezer clamps, alligator clamps or butterfly clamps.

Handcuffs

While most female sex toys can also be used with a partner, some toys are designed specifically for this purpose. Handcuffs are a great entry toy for those starting to explore sex toys and bondage play. They are restraint toys that can be used to attach two wrists together or to attach a wrist to something else like a bedpost or chair to restrict movement and limit the wearer's ability to touch.

The point of this type of toy is to enhance the sensitivity on the wearer's body by removing their ability to touch or move. Handcuffs are also a great way to ease into power play and explore dominant and submissive roles in a relationship.

Best Sex Toys for Beginners

Finding the best sex toys for beginners is quite easy if you know what to look for. Start with a toy for an area you already know gives you great pleasure and start with something small. If a toy is too small, you can still use it, but if a toy is too big, you may struggle to use it properly or even at all. Regardless of the type of toy, always buy high-quality sex toys. This doesn't necessarily mean you need to buy the most expensive toy available.

Check out reviews from customers to find a toy that is body-safe and will last for more than just a couple of uses.
